Sydney entrepreneur Paul Burkett takes the high road in defamation case

Industry: Business

Renowned Sydney entrepreneur Paul Burkett was recommended by legal counsel to pursue defamation after a 2017 incident with the media. Despite the recommendations, he decided to move forward and use his experience as fuel for helping others overcome hardships in business and life.

Sydney, Australia (PRUnderground) June 6th, 2019

The story which aired on ‘Sunday Night’ framed Paul as the ‘headman’ of a global organisation which was under scrutiny for its sales work for well-known charity organisations. The company in question had multiple divisions including electricity, food and telecommunications. Each operated as an individual businesses, separate from each other.

‘I was the electricity guy, but I was scapegoated for issues that happened in a completely different sector, in different businesses – which was in regards to charities,’ Burkett said.

As the definition explains, defamation is the act of communicating false statements about a person that injure the reputation of that person.

‘My kids even said to me, why are they talking to you about this stuff and not all of the people working in and in charge of those businesses?’

‘I think I was picked as a scapegoat because I was the only one with a profile and I was also known for doing flamboyant keynote talks at the companies seminars, making me an easy target.’

Mr Burkett acknowledged that the company he was involved with had some questions to answer and he doesn’t condone all of their practices, but explained that his exploitation by the media had significant personal and business impacts.

‘The experience seriously impacted my career, other businesses I was involved in, my personal life and even mental health – I had to pick up the pieces of my life from the fallout for a long time.’

Drawing on his experience and setbacks, Paul is now driven by the purpose of helping people ‘fail forward’ and bounce back from the inevitable hurdles in business and life.

‘It is all about empowering people in their business and life and coaching on how to fail without smashing your face on the pavement,’ he said.

Mr Burkett has also overcome a heart condition with exercise and now owns a gym equipment business, an F45 and has stakes in a boxing gym. He has also been instrumental in developing sales teams and start-ups across multiple industries – consulting, speaking and ultimately driving business outcomes.
